C++ language mappings

This section details the mapping of IDL constructs to the C++ programming language. The C++ bindings and the C bindings are designed to be binary compatible, which allows C clients to directly call C++ and vice-versa. This requirement depends on the use C++ compilers that generate virtual function tables compatible with OS Services C virtual function tables.